I just thoughtnof something else about Jethro's education.When they first got to Beverly Hills,Jed told Miss Hathaway that Jethro had gone to school in Oxford.Miss Hathaway didn't know how backwoods they were- and didn't know about the Oxford elementary school in Bugtussle-built by the river where the ox would ford.

Miss Hathaway:I assume when he was younger,he went to Eaton!
Jed:Jethro went to eatin' the day he was born.
